Hillside Gardening
Landscape Designer Connie Beck will show you how to make the most of gardening on a slope! Topics to be covered include erosion control, proper plant choices, terracing, and retaining walls. A colorful slideshow of several San Diego hillside gardens will reveal the creative possibilities unique to this style of gardening.

Water Smart Landscaping Beautiful Landscaping on a Low Water Budget
Landscape designer Connie Beck takes the mystery out of Xeriscape and shows you why Xeriscape is not "Zero-Scape"! Learn the seven principles of this water-wise gardening method, plant selection, and planting techniques. Start saving  water while still creating a beautiful garden.

Organic Fruit & Vegetable Gardening
Consumers have a heightened interest in sustainable living. Because of this, many people are willing to invest time and (some) money into their yards to provide family entertainment without travel. This course will provide you information on organic stewardship of your garden, contribute to a healthy lifestyle by helping the nutrition benefits of eating fresh-grown produce, reduce your carbon footprint by growing your own food, enhance the appearance of your yard, and people you with a fun family activity for all ages.
Cuyamaca College, Room M-111
Organic History, the NOP, different  farming practices, soil building, irrigation, Fall weeds and insects, Fall crops, and companion planting will be covered.
